The Rev. Jerome Ross will be the guest speaker at the 38th Annual NAACP Freedom Fund Banquet this weekend.

A full house is expected to attend the event being held at 5 p.m. Feb. 15 at Temple Beth El, 33027 Bridge Road, said Michael Ricks, program chairman.

Ross is the pastor of Providence Park Baptist Church in Richmond and is an associate professor of Hebrew Bible in the Virginia Union University’s School of Theology.

Doc Christian, a Portsmouth native and assistant music minister at Calvary Baptist Church in Norfolk, will provide entertainment.

Christian is the community affairs director for Clear Channel-Norfolk/WSVY-105.3, host producer for a program called &uot;Joy In The Morning,&uot; and technical producer for the Tom Joyner Morning Show. He also recorded with the late Rev. James Cleveland.

The Rev. Charles L. Harvin, pastor of Macedonia African Methodist Episcopal Church, will serve as master of ceremonies.
